- ChatGPT是什么?
ChatGPT是一个Openai公司出品的聊天接口,网上也称之为ChatGPT聊天机器人,它可以模拟人类对话,通过图灵测试。ChatGPT是由GPT-3.5系列中的一个模型微调而成,而且ChatGPT和GPT-3.5是在Azure AI超级计算基础设施上训练的。。
2. ChatGPT能干什么?
ChatGPT可以智能问答、生成代码、修复bug、多语翻译、文本改写、在线问诊、编写情景脚本、诗歌、小说,可以说无所不能。在与用户互动时,即使用户不能准确地描述问题时,ChatGPT也能通过循循善诱,充分挖掘用户的真实需求,给出用户需要的答案。并且回答的内容覆盖多维度,内容质量并不亚于谷歌的“搜索引擎”。
3. ChatGPT的模型局限
ChatGPT的模型缺乏对2020年8月以后发生的事件的了解,如果要让它了解当前的时事,得使用加强版的插件。
模型是最可靠的主流英语,可能在区域或群体方言上表现不佳。
4.ChatGPT的调用次数限制
每个用户,每天调用次数为1000次,超过1000次就会禁止调用。
5.ChatGPT的回答字符限制
最大字符限制15000字符,超过字符则无法生成回答。
6. 如何稳定地调用ChatGPT的回答?
网页版目前访问量太大,以致于它的服务器都不得不限流了。所以你可以尝试采用一些稳定的方法,使用它的服务。
调用它的API服务,不管它的网页版如何速度慢,无需用魔法,采用Python调用它的API,获取服务非常稳定,而且速度很快。如果你想学习的话,可以参考我的视频:
7. ChatGPT还可以免费用多久?
根据ChatGPT的官网,免费给的API额度可以用到2023年的4月1日。
8.ChatGPT的API额度是多少?
每一个注册的用户都会给18美元的free trial免费额度。我的个人使用情况显示,每天调用200次,大约消费1美元。所以,18美元能调用3600次。
9.ChatGPT国内能访问吗?
目前,国内是无法访问的,除非你使用Python调用它的API。你也可以关注知乎这个问答:
10. 能否语音访问ChatGPT呢?
可以的,已经有人在hf上搭建了一个项目,可以用于语音访问ChatGPT,原里就是利用网页录音,然后进行转写,转写后发送到ChatGPT的服务器,然后得到应答。
12. 如何申请ChatGPT的账号?
有点儿小复杂,注册过程需要验证注册的邮箱和非国内手机号。具体的方法可以参考我在知乎的文章:
13. ChatGPT的调用demo中各参数的意思是什么?
根据ChatGPT的回答,其Python调用代码的意义如下:
14. 如何调用openai的API呢?
To use OpenAIs API with Python, you will first need to sign up for an OpenAI API key. You can do this by visiting the OpenAI website and creating an account. Once you have an API key, you can use it with Python by installing the openai
Python package, which provides a Python interface for accessing OpenAIs API.
Here is an example of how you might use the openai
package to access OpenAIs API in Python:
# Import the openai module
import openai
# Set the API key
openai.api_key = "<your_api_key>" #这里API要加入环境变量。
# Use the API to generate a response to a prompt
response = openai.Completion.create(
engine="text-davinci-002", #这里是调用的模型。
prompt="The quick brown fox jumped over the lazy dog.",
max_tokens=1024,
temperature=0.5,
)
# Print the response
print(response["choices"][0]["text"])
In this example, we use the openai.Completion.create()
method to generate a response to a given prompt using OpenAIs text generation model. This method takes several parameters, including the name of the model to use and the prompt to generate a response for. It returns a JSON object containing the response, which we can then access and print.
。。。不断更新中。。。